2009-12-22 5 views
8

Ich habe gerade die neueste Version von Galileo Eclipse installiert. Ich fügte das späteste adt plugin hinzu und konfigurierte es, um mein Android SDK (r4) zu benutzen. Leider ist das Eclipse-Plugin wiggin out. aus irgendeinem Grund, es kann nicht finden (Ausführen?) die Android-Tools. Ich bekomme diesen Fehler auf dem Eclipse-Projekt:android eclipse plugin kann keine gültigen Pfade finden

Fehler beim Ausführen aapt. Bitte überprüfen Sie aapt liegt an ~/android-sdk-linux_86/platforms/Android-1.6/tools/aapt

aber hier ist die Ausgabe von ls:

ls -al ~/android-sdk-linux_86/platforms/android-1.6/tools/aapt 
-rwxrwxrwx 1 solid solid 3416259 2009-12-18 21:02 /home/solid/android-sdk-linux_86/platforms/android-1.6/tools/aapt 

Wenn ich das versuchen läuft Programm direkt, ich sehe die folgenden:

~/android-sdk-linux_86/platforms/android-1.6/tools/aapt 
bash: /home/solid/android-sdk-linux_86/platforms/android-1.6/tools/aapt: No such file or directory 

ich entpackte nur die sdk und installiert die Plattformen und ls ‚d es so dass ich weiß, dass es da ist.

Ich habe versucht, das Projekt von der Befehlszeile neu zu erstellen (die funktioniert), aber wenn ich es in Eclipse importieren, bekomme ich den gleichen Fehler.

BTW ist das Linux-amd 64

Antwort

17

Etwas hier sehr falsch ist. Diese beiden Linien widersprechen sich:

$ ls -al ~/android-sdk-linux_86/platforms/android-1.6/tools/aapt 
-rwxrwxrwx 1 solid solid 3416259 2009-12-18 21:02 /home/solid/android-sdk-linux_86/platforms/android-1.6/tools/aapt 

$ ~/android-sdk-linux_86/platforms/android-1.6/tools/aapt 
bash: /home/solid/android-sdk-linux_86/platforms/android-1.6/tools/aapt: No such file or directory 

Die Datei kann einfach nicht einen Augenblick existieren, dann aufhören, in den nächsten zu existieren.

Ich glaube nicht, dass dies durch Ausführen von amd64 verursacht wird, da ich vermuten würde, dass Sie einen anderen, beschreibenden Fehler geben würden. Davon abgesehen, stellen Sie sicher, die ia32-libs installiert haben:

# Assuming you're on Ubuntu 
$ apt-get install ia32-libs 

Mein einziger Rat vollständig zu versuchen, wäre Ihre SDK-Installation zu löschen und neu zu installieren es von Grund auf neu.

+0

ia32-libs hat es für mich getan. Vielen Dank! –

Verwandte Themen